Hi there, 

I had to download an Adobe subscription for uni in the middle of last year (so not a full year since joining). I needed a range of apps such as Photoshop, InDesign, Illustrator, Acrobat and more. I downloaded through the uni and the links provided. I am still being charged the same price as when I originally signed up but I am not able to access any of the apps. I was charged less than a week ago and can still update the apps. When trying to use them it pops up a notification to start a 7-day free trial or to buy the apps. I have no clue how to fix this? Could this be due to the school year finishing in December - if so, why am I still be charged for apps I cant use? (just a thought)

Try the steps mentioned in the following link
https://helpx.adobe.com/hk_en/manage-account/kb/stop-creative-cloud-trial-mode-after-purchase.html
If it doesn't work, then you need to contact support.
Login to your account and navigate to the URL below. Make sure that the browser has cookies enabled, and all script blockers are disabled.
https://helpx.adobe.com/contact.html
Click on the chat icon on the bottom right, and type AGENT to avoid bots and talk to a human.
Also, be mindful of answering anyone who sends you a private message. See the following for more information about scammers
